Across the 2018, 2020 and 2021 model years, the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I motorcycle has supplied wet/running weights ranging from 238.1 lb (108 kg) and dry weights ranging from 233.7 lb (106 kg), depending on model year.
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weight overview
This is a genuinely light bike. That usually makes parking, pushing it around a garage and catching small low-speed balance errors easier than on larger motorcycles.

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weight & related specs
| Model years covered | 2018, 2020, 2021 |
|---|---|
| Wet / running weight | 238.1 lb (108 kg) |
| Dry weight | 233.7 lb (106 kg) |
| Engine displacement | 124 cc to 124.1 cc |
| Torque | 7 lb-ft (9.5 Nm) |
| Fuel capacity | 1.06 US gal (4 L) |
| Full-tank fuel weight (estimated) | 6.6 lb (3 kg) |

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weight FAQ
How much does the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weigh?
For the model years covered here, wet/running weight is 238.1 lb (108 kg), while dry weight is 233.7 lb (106 kg). Do not treat dry and wet figures as interchangeable.

What does a full tank of gas weigh on the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I?
A full tank works out to about 6.6 lb (3 kg) from the listed 1.06 US gal (4 L) capacity. Actual fuel density varies slightly, so treat it as a practical estimate.
What does the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weigh with a 180 lb rider?
The approximate combined total is 418.1 lb (189.6 kg) with a 180 lb rider, based on the representative wet/running weight used on this page.
What is the estimated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I weight with a full tank of gas?
Using the listed dry weight plus the calculated fuel mass, the estimated weight with a full tank is 240.3 lb (109 kg). That still may not equal official curb weight because dry-weight definitions can exclude other fluids or equipment.
What is the Suzuki Skydrive 125 FI dry-to-wet weight difference?
Available years with both measurements show about 4.4 lb (2 kg) added between dry and ready-to-ride figures. Fuel explains part of it, while oil, coolant and specification definitions can explain the rest.
